Sada Baby Arrested for Alleged Possession of a Controlled Substance in Michigan

Sada Baby has been arrested again in Michigan, this time in connection with alleged possession of a controlled substance. The rapper, whose real name is Casada Sorrell, was taken into custody on Tuesday, April 8, in the Detroit suburb of Sterling Heights, according to online jail records.

At the time of writing, Sada Baby is still in custody, with local reports confirming that the Sterling Heights Police Department made the arrest. He is reportedly facing charges for possession of a controlled substance in an amount less than 25 grams. The bond for his release is listed as “no bond,” meaning he is likely to remain in custody for now.

We have reached out to the Macomb County Sheriff’s Office, the Sterling Heights Police Department, and a representative for Sada Baby for further comment. Updates to this story may follow as new details emerge.

This latest arrest is connected to a previous incident from January, which involved a warrant for driving without a license.

During that arrest, police discovered what was described at the time as “illegal contraband” in Sada Baby’s vehicle, though specifics on the substance have not been clarified. Following this discovery, a new warrant was issued in April for possession of a controlled substance.

Fans may recall that Sada Baby addressed the January arrest on social media, reassuring followers on Instagram that he was “super good” despite the incident.

Latest Music Release

Despite his ongoing legal troubles, Sada Baby has been active in his music career. In March, he dropped Bridge Kard Blessings, a 14-track project that marked his first full-length release since SkuBop in 2023.

The project includes a previously released remix of JMSN’s viral hit “Soft Spot,” continuing his momentum in the music world despite the setbacks.
